Quasar UI QMediaPlayer 项目启动与配置教程
1. 项目目录结构及介绍
Quasar UI QMediaPlayer 是一个基于 Quasar 框架的媒体播放器组件。项目的目录结构如下:
/ui
:独立的 npm 包,包含了 QMediaPlayer 组件的核心代码。/app-extension
:Quasar 应用扩展,用于集成到 Quasar 应用中。/demo
:演示项目,包含了文档、示例和演示代码。/docs
:项目文档。.github
:GitHub 的工作流和模板文件。.gitignore
:定义了 Git 忽略的文件和目录。LICENSE
:项目的 MIT 许可证文件。README.md
:项目的自述文件,包含了项目描述、安装和使用指南。
2. 项目的启动文件介绍
项目的启动主要依赖于 Quasar CLI。以下是在本地启动演示项目的基本步骤:
-
确保已经全局安装了 Quasar CLI:
npm i -g @quasar/cli
-
在
/demo
目录中,安装项目依赖:yarn
-
使用 Quasar CLI 启动开发服务器:
quasar dev
这样,演示项目就会在本地开发环境中启动,并通过浏览器访问。
3. 项目的配置文件介绍
Quasar UI QMediaPlayer 的配置主要通过 Quasar 的配置文件进行。以下是一些关键的配置项:
-
quasar.conf.js
:这是 Quasar 应用的主配置文件,定义了插件、CSS 预处理器、构建配置等。例如,如果你的项目需要使用全屏功能,你需要在
quasar.conf.js
中添加AppFullscreen
插件:return { framework: { plugins: [ 'AppFullscreen' ] } };
-
config.xml
:如果你的项目是针对 iOS 平台构建的,并且想要使用playsinline
属性,你需要在config.xml
文件中添加以下配置:<preference name="AllowInlineMediaPlayback" value="true" />
这些配置文件是项目能够顺利运行的重要部分,确保正确配置它们对于项目的稳定运行至关重要。
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考